Jordan - Import of Petroleum Based Lubricanting Oil

Since 2014, Jordan Import of Petroleum Based Lubricanting Oil decreased by 1.2% year on year. With $11,045,426.79 in 2019, the country was ranked number 57 among other countries in Import of Petroleum Based Lubricanting Oil. Jordan is overtaken by Serbia, which was ranked number 56 at $11,671,345.83 and is followed by Croatia at $9,954,890.19. China lead the ranking with $668,572,531.43 in 2019, that is +3.3% compared to 2018. Germany, Russia and Canada resp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Solomon Islands witnessed the best average annual growth at +100.1% per year, while Tanzania was the worst growing country at -26% per year.
